First, let’s answer the burning question: What is Pilates? Pilates is a system of exercises using specialized equipment designed to improve physical strength, flexibility and posture, and enhance mental awareness. Named after German physical fitness specialist Joseph Pilates (1880-1967), this unique system of corrective exercises — originally called “Contrology”— can offer incredible results. Pilates strengthens and lengthens the muscles without creating bulk and is also helpful in preventing and rehabilitating injuries, improving posture and enhancing flexibility, circulation and balance. An Interesting History Joseph Pilates was a frail child with rickets, asthma and rheumatic fever. Determined to become stronger, he dedicated himself to building both his body and mind. His conditioning routine worked, and he became an accomplished gymnast, skier, boxer and diver. During World War I, Pilates was captured and served an internment on the Isle of Man.
